Your Health Results, Sooner
Starting Jan. 20, the MHS GENESIS Patient Portal will send you a notification when new results or notes are available. Sometimes, this may mean you see your results before your care team reviews them. You’ll need to verify that an active email account is associated with your patient portal to get these notifications. Check your settings to verify your email address.

Mobile prescription activation
Mobile prescription activation now available at Kimbrough. We will process prescriptions entered into the system within the last 7 days. Prescriptions entered into the system older than 7 days, please call 301-677-8800, option 4 to activate the prescription.

Learn how TRICARE covers breast cancer screenings
Screening for breast cancer is important. That’s because it’s the second most common cancer in women in the U.S., according to the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ention. Fortunately, getting preventive screenings can help detect breast cancer before you show any signs or symptoms. Your age and your risk for breast cancer determine which tests are recommended for you and covered by TRICARE.

New virtual urgent care option for TRICARE Prime beneficiaries in the US
Are you enrolled in a TRICARE Prime plan? If you see a primary care manager at a military hospital or clinic, you may now have a new way to get urgent care. The Defense Health Agency has expanded its virtual urgent care options in the U.S. This allows TRICARE Prime enrollees ages 12 and older to schedule virtual urgent care through the Military Health System Nurse Advice Line.

Important Notice to Patients: Limit Visitors to Emergency Room to Protect Against Cold, Flu, and Respiratory Illnesses
As part of our ongoing commitment to patient safety and public health, Kimbrough Ambulatory Care Center urges patients and their families to limit the number of people accompanying a loved one to the emergency room. With the current increase in seasonal illnesses such as the cold, flu, and respiratory infections, we are advising that only essential visitors should be in ER waiting areas.
